" This spectacular and unique architect designed property commands iconic status in the high amenity Trinity area. The property is a bespoke villa over three storeys with stunning views directly onto Wardie Bay and across to Fife.
The property is of pleasing modern design, the slope of the roof reflecting the slope of the hillside on which the house sits. The front elevation is dominated by full length continuous glazing which maximizes enjoyment of the spectacular views.
Internally the property extends over three floors and has an internal area of around 2500 square feet. The second floor comprises a large open plan mezzanine (currently used as a sitting room) with fifth bedroom/ office off. The first floor includes a large lounge/dining room overlooking the Firth, dining kitchen, utility, study with views of the Firth and WC. The ground floor comprises a large hall, family bathroom and 4 bedrooms all with views of the water, including a master bedroom with en-suite. The fourth bedroom has an adjoining room

(currently used as a gym) with potential for conversion to form an en-suite and dressing room, thereby creating a further substantial master/guest bedroom suite
The property has been finished to a very high specification throughout both in terms of materials and appliances. It is light, well insulated and energy efficient, and is fully double glazed and has gas central heating throughout. The internal decoration is clear, modern and stylish with an oak staircase with stainless steel balustrades, oak doors and solid oak hardwood floors. The bathrooms are marble tiled and incorporate electric under floor heating. In ceiling speakers are fitted in selected rooms.
Garden
The ground floor level offers direct access to a private child-friendly front garden from each of the bedrooms via varnished wood double glazed doors. The back door leads to steps down the side of the building to the front garden, and up to a sloping rear garden mainly laid to lawn which offers potential for the enthusiastic gardener. The front door opens onto a large south facing terrace with views over the Forth, suitable for summer dining or watching the boats sail by over a glass of wine
Garage
The driveway leads to a large single garage with remote control electrically operated door. The garage has water, power and light.

The property is situated in the high amenity Trinity area, and it is a short walk to Lomond Park, Lomond Tennis Club and Lomond Bowling Club. The Royal Botanical Gardens and Inverleith Park are also within easy reach. Wardie Beach (frequented by Charles Darwin for fossil hunting whilst a student at the University) is also a short walk away and offers opportunities for rock-pooling, dog walking and sea fishing. In addition, the sea front cycle path runs directly across from the property, and provides convenient access to the rest of Edinburgh?s cycle path network. The property lies within the catchment area of the highly regarded Wardie Primary School, and is within a short drive of Edinburgh Academy, Stewarts Melville, St George's School for Girls and Fettes College. The restaurants and cafes at Newhaven Harbour (Loch Fyne Oyster Bar, Prezzo, Porto & Fi, David Lloyd) are within walking distance, and both Ocean Terminal (M&S, Vue Cinema, Debenhams) and the restaurants and bars in the Shore area are within easy reach. A branch of most major supermarkets, including Waitrose, are a short drive from the property.
